BELGIUM The once-mighty motocross power that gave us Roger De Coster, Joel Robert, Stefan and Harry Everts, the Geboers brother, Georges Jobe, Joel Smets, and many, many more is having a revival of sorts, as four Belgians are signed to factory deals for MXGP ‘23: Stefan’s son Liam Everts (KTM), MX2 title favorite Jago Geerts (Yamaha), and 16-year-old twin brothers Sacha (KTM) and Luca Coenen (Husqvarna).
SUZUKI The struggling member of the old “Big Four” Japanese brands decided to bow out of MotoGP after decades of being in the mix. And in the words of our own Jason Weigandt, they did “the most Suzuki of Suzuki things” by winning their last race as an official participant, with Alex Rins winning their farewell race at Valencia, Spain. But just when it seemed like Suzuki might be done done as a top-level racing brand, Ken Roczen pops up on social media on a #94 RM-Z450. Stay tuned.
